Most models for volcanic tremor rely on specific properties of the geometry, structure and constitution of volcanic conduits as well as the gas content of the erupting magma. Here, a model is used of a silicic magma rising in a conduit as a columnar plug to demonstrate that, for most geologically relevant conditions, the magma column will oscillate or 'wag' against the restoring force of a highly vesicular annulus of sheared bubbles at observed tremor frequencies. The frequencies produced are relatively insensitive to the conduit structure and geometry.
